After US threatens ban, what could TikTok’s next move be? | DW News

The US is poised to ban TikTok unless the social media app cuts its ties to China. US lawmakers overwhelmingly voted for a bill which forces the Chinese owner to sell the app to an owner from a country other than China or face a total ban. The US is that the social media service could be used to collect American citizens’ personal data and that it poses a threat to national security. China has protested, saying it’s unfair to use those arguments to bring down the competitive advantage of other countries.
